The Tampa Bay Buccaneers’ offense continues to struggle.

The Bucs haven’t eclipsed 21 points in a game since their matchup against the Texans on Nov. 5 and have only eclipsed that mark once in seven games, doing it the last time aside from Houston in Week 4 when the team beat the Saints 26-9. Tampa Bay just isn’t quite clicking on that side of the ball, but there were still some moments of hope like there are every Sunday — running back Rachaad White continues to be a weapon in the offense and wideout Mike Evans did Mike Evans things in the 27-20 losing effort.
